The Tyrone footballers have made just one change for this Saturday’s All Ireland qualifier against Meath at Croke Park.
Mickey Harte has kept faith with the majority of the side that started last weekend’s win over Kildare.
Ciaran McGinley returns at wing-back meaning Ryan McKenna moves into the corner with Aidan McCrory dropping to the bench.
Meanwhile, the Cork hurlers also make one change for Sunday’s All Ireland quarter-final against Kilkenny at Semple Stadium.
Newtownshandrum’s Jamie Coughlan has been included at corner-forward by Jimmy Barry Murphy, which means that Cian McCarthy drops to the bench.
Patrick Horgan starts at full-forward after he successfully appealed against the red card he was shown during the Munster final defeat to Limerick.
